Innovation doesn’t happen by accident.

Innovation happens when ideas collide with pioneering people and are cultivated by creators, capital, and community. In 2017, the first Inside Outside Innovation Summit took place to build, foster, and grow these collisions. Since then, over 3,000 attendees, 100+ speakers, and 300+ startups have gathered in Nebraska to showcase innovation & entrepreneurship.

An Amazing Lineup of Speakers & Sessions

We’ll be announcing the full slate of speakers and sessions soon. Here’s a quick preview of a few of them…

Alistair Croll – Alistair is a serial entrepreneur, founder of Year One Labs, organizer of the FWD50 conference, and bestselling author of Lean Analytics and the upcoming book Just Evil Enough, which offers a playbook for a new kind of marketing.

Tam Danier – Tam is a managing director at Good Ideas Only. GIO is an insights, strategy design studio that guides clients through discovery, design, and delivery. Tam has worked with companies such as Apple, Twitter, General Assembly, Anthem, T-Mobile, and Deloitte.

Kaiser Yang – Kaiser is the author of Crack the Code, 8 Surprising Keys to Unlock Innovation, and CEO and co-founder of Platypus Labs, a global innovation research, consulting, and training company.

Sean Sheppard – Sean is the Managing Partner at FifthRow (U+), the world’s leading corporate venture builder and digital innovation firm.

Scott Wolfson - Scott is a Managing Director at Valize, with extensive experience in innovation, customer experience, and digital transformation. His career highlights include co-founding KPMG's Innovation Labs and contributing to developing new AI service offerings at BCG.

Mickayla Rosard - Mickayla is a Partner at Groove Capital, a pre-seed venture fund and angel network focused on Minnesota companies. Additionally, Mickayla is a Fellow at Forge North, leading their statewide initiative to engage more angels, especially women and underrepresented investors.

Luke Hansen - Luke is the founder and CEO of CompanyCam and spends his days supplying the vision, acquiring funds, hiring the best folks around, and distracting all the smart people he’s hired with long-winded anecdotes. Luke’s mission is to get CompanyCam in the hands of every contractor on the planet, and he won’t rest until he’s done.

Morgan Keldsen - Morgan is Chief International Officer at Kizik, the footwear industry's leading hands-free footwear brand and one that Inc. Magazine claims could be the next billion dollar sneaker brand. Morgan’s career highlights include work growing the Asia-Pacific business for Nike, Converse, Vans, and Stussy.

Sarah Plantenberg - Sarah is author of Driving Outcomes: An Actionable Guide to Accelerate Business Results Through Culture. Sarah Plantenberg is an expert in the field of human factors who has worked at the intersection of human beings, technology, and business processes for more than 20 years. As co-founder of the IBM Garage, a lean cloud adoption consultancy, and its companion methodology, IBM Garage Methodology, Sarah has helped springboard hundreds of organizations into their digital transformation journey.

Rachel Joy Victor - Rachel Joy Victor is the co-founder of FBRC.AI, a company focused on creating AI-supported tools for the future of content production--from films to games to location-based experiences. Rachel's work as a designer, strategist, and worldbuilder for emerging technologies (XR/AI/web3) focuses on creating cohesive narrative, brand, and product experiences. She designs for a range of applications: from multiplatform narratives and gaming experiences, to tools and platforms, to spaces and cities. Rachel’s clients have included Disney, HBO, Technicolor, Vans, Ford, Nike, Havas, Meow Wolf, Niantic, and many more.

Megan Elliott - Megan Elliott is the Johnny Carson Endowed Director of the Carson Center for Emerging Media Arts at the University of Nebraska–Lincoln, where she leads innovative programs in virtual production, film, and interactive media. She serves as AR/VR coordinator for the NIH-funded Worlds of Connections project, building partnerships in network science education. Additionally, Elliott advises on UNL's Research Advisory Board to advance interdisciplinary research and societal impact.
